Live Casino vs RNG Games Fundamentals: Building Your Foundation
What Is a Live Casino?
A live casino streams real dealers, tables, and chips to your screen. You interact with a human dealer via chat, just like in a brick‑and‑mortar venue. The video feed runs in real time, so each hand or spin is truly random. Live games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. Because a person handles the cards, many players feel the experience is more trustworthy.
What Are RNG (Random Number Generator) Games?
RNG games are powered by computer algorithms that generate outcomes instantly. Slots, video poker, and many table games fall into this category. The software follows strict regulatory standards, ensuring each spin is independent and fair. RNG games are available 24/7, with no waiting for a dealer. They also offer a huge variety of themes and bonus features.
Odds and RTP Basics
RTP stands for “return to player.” It tells you the average percentage of wagered money a game will pay back over time. Live dealer games usually have RTPs similar to their RNG counterparts because the same mathematical rules apply. However, live games often have lower house edges on classics like blackjack (around 0.5 % with optimal play) compared to many slots that sit at 92‑96 % RTP. Volatility describes how often and how big wins can be. Low‑volatility slots pay small amounts frequently, while high‑volatility slots pay big jackpots rarely. Understanding these terms helps you compare odds accurately.
